| 1. Make
a mask for the word "happy" (from Mega Happy
Perfectly Clear™ set) by stamping happy
first onto scrap paper. Use a craft knife and cutting mat
to carefully cut out interior of each letter.
2. Stamp happy onto a 2" x 5-1/4"
white cardstock panel using Starlite Black ink. Place the
mask on top of word. Stamp a different image from Spooky
Halloween Perfectly Clear™ set into each letter
using Persimmon ink.
3. Stamp halloween from Seasonal
Swirls Perfectly Clear™ set over "happy"
using Onyx Black ink. Sponge edges of panel with Persimmon
ink and layer onto a 2-1/4" x 5-1/2" panel of black
cardstock.
4. Fold an 8-1/2" x 5-1/2" panel of Festive
cardstock in half to form card base. Randomly stamp bats
and moons from Spooky Halloween Perfectly
Clear™ set over front using Persimmon ink.
5. Stamp spiders randomly onto a 2-1/2"
x 4-1/4" panel of black cardstock using Moonlight White
ink. Tear edges and glue to left side of card.
6. Glue "happy" panel to front of card.
Attach spider from Spider Webs Class
A'Peels™ to tail of the word "halloween."
Color in the spider's eyes with a white gel pen.
